How to Make Low‐Protein Dog Food

Brown 1 pound of ground pork., Choose a vegetable., Choose a starch., Choose an organ meat., Chose a calcium supplement., Choose a fish oil capsule., Mix all of the above together into any container you can seal tightly.

7 Steps 2 min read Medium

Step-by-Step Guide

  1. Step 1: Brown 1 pound of ground pork.

     Drain any fat.

    You can substitute 1 pound of ground beef (80% lean).
  2. Step 2: Choose a vegetable.

    You can use canned (no sodium/salt added) or you can steam or boil any of these.

    Prepare 3 cups cooked.

    Carrots (diced or sliced) Sweet potato (diced or sliced) Green beans Beets (diced or sliced) , Cook according to package directions.  Prepare 2 cups cooked.

    Rice (white) Macaroni Malt O Meal (original not chocolate flavor) , Organ meat is an essential part of this diet.

    It contains vitamins, nutrients and minerals your dog needs.

    You need 3 ounces total.

    Dice finely before or after cooking.

    You can cook this with the ground meat.

    Beef or calves liver Chicken livers Pork liver , Go to the human vitamin section of your store.

    You need a total of 1,000 mg in this recipe.

    You can use one TUMS ULTRA in place of calcium.

    Crush the tablet in between two spoons until it is fine powder. , You can get this in the same place you got the calcium.  Do not use cod liver fish oil capsules.

    These capsules are coated with gelatin and liquid inside.

    You need 1,000 mg in this recipe.

    Take a push pin, safety pin, needle and poke a hole in the end of it.

    Squeeze contents into meat mixture. , Store in refrigerator.

    Feed 1/2 cup of this daily for every 8 pounds of dog.

    If your dog weighs 5 pounds, feed him half a cup.

    If he weighs 10 pounds, feed 1 cup.

    Every dog is different and you will need to adjust according to each.

    Some dogs may need less to maintain weight, some may need more.
